How to provide temperature refuges and shaded microhabitats to help exotic animals avoid heat stress outdoors.
A practical guide for guardians to design outdoor spaces that coolly shelter exotic pets, offering shade, airflow, moisture, and safe retreats that reduce heat stress while supporting welfare and natural behaviors.
July 21, 2025
Facebook X Reddit
As outdoor environments become warmer and more variable, exotic pets like reptiles, amphibians, birds, and small mammals face heat stress that can compromise health, appetite, and activity levels. Providing temperature refuges means creating a mosaic of microclimates where individuals can retreat when conditions become uncomfortable. Key ideas include alternating shaded zones with sun patches, ensuring accessible vertical space, and allowing animals to move freely between areas without feeling trapped. Consider how gusts of breeze, damp substrates, and cool water sources can combine to create pleasant resting spots. Clarity about species-specific needs helps you tailor refuges rather than applying generic, unsuitable features.
Start with a baseline assessment of the outdoor area, noting sun exposure in different hours, prevailing wind directions, and the presence of porous ground or porous rocks that permit heat dissipation. Build a network of microhabitats that differ in temperature by several degrees, so an animal can choose according to its momentary tolerance. Use shade cloth, deciduous vegetation, or artificial canopies to reduce radiant heat while maintaining air movement. Provide both high and low resting spots so you can accommodate climbing species and ground-dwelling animals alike. Above all, ensure access to fresh water and easily reachable hiding places that feel secure and non-threatening.
Layered shelter and airflow reduce heat stress for many species.
For reptiles and some invertebrates, refuges should emphasize slow cooling rather than abrupt temperature shifts. A sheltered log or rock crevice can maintain cooler temperatures during the heat of the day, while a nearby open basking platform offers intermittent warmth for metabolism. Materials matter: pale or reflective surfaces reduce heat absorption, while dark, textured options retain heat longer when needed. Arrange refuges so that animals can retreat immediately if a predator or disturbance appears. Install ramps, ledges, or stepping stones to connect zones, making relocation between microhabitats intuitive and stress-free.

Amphibians and some geckos appreciate humidity and moisture as part of their cooling strategy. Create damp microhabitats with shallow pools, misting systems, or damp leaf litter that preserves ambient humidity. Avoid stagnant water that promotes disease or algae growth. Position moisture sources near shaded areas to maintain lower temperatures and prevent rapid evaporation. Provide escape routes and consistent shelter coverage so animals feel secure during hottest periods. Regularly monitor humidity levels and substrate moisture to prevent desiccation or mold. Balancing dryness and dampness is essential for maintaining health and natural behaviors.
Practical design tips to enhance refuges without stressing animals.
In warm climates, tree canopies and vertical structures dramatically increase available refuges. Suspend shade fabrics at varying heights to simulate natural shade patterns created by tall vegetation. A dense understory plus a light canopy creates a patchwork of microhabitats that allows animals to choose comfort over time. For birds and arboreal mammals, climbing frames with textured surfaces help disperse heat through circulation as they move. Ensure perches are stable and non-slip, and that any harnesses or cages are sized to permit swift movement away from sunlit areas. Monitoring behavior helps you adjust shelter density and location.

Ground-dwelling species benefit from cooling pockets near the earth’s surface. Use a mix of cool, porous substrates like sandy loam, gravel, or bark mulch that hold moisture but drain well. Construct shallow, shaded depressions or burrows that remain cooler than the surrounding air. Access to these pockets should be easy from multiple directions, enabling rapid retreat if a threat appears. Regularly clean and refresh substrates to prevent odor buildup and fungal growth. Consider how seasonal changes affect substrate temperature and adapt refuges accordingly to sustain consistent comfort.
Balance moisture, shade, and airflow to protect multiple species.
When planning, measure rather than assume temperatures across the outdoor area. Use a reliable thermometer placed at several heights and locations to capture sun exposure, shade availability, and air movement. Record readings at different times of day, especially during peak heat. Use these data to reposition refuges so they remain within preferred ranges for various species. Avoid energy-intensive cooling devices that can alter animal behavior or create moisture problems. Natural solutions should dominate, with mechanical aids reserved for extreme conditions. Your goal is to offer choices rather than impose a single condition on every animal.
Accessibility and safety should guide every refuge installation. Ensure gates and exits remain unblocked, and that animals can reach shade without crossing hazardous areas. Avoid loose materials that can entangle tails or legs. Use non-toxic paints and coatings on artificial structures to prevent chemical exposure during warm months. Maintain hoses or misting lines with proper routing to prevent tripping hazards. Regular inspections help detect wear and tear, loose fasteners, or gaps that could trap an individual. A thoughtful, well-constructed refuge system reduces stress and encourages natural exploration.

Birds and reptiles often rely on a balance of shade and airflow to regulate temperature efficiently. Create overhead canopies that filter intense sun while allowing breezes to pass through. Use perforated panels or latticework to maximize ventilation without exposing animals to direct heat. Place refuges in locations that remain shaded for most of the day, but allow occasional sun for vitamin D synthesis. Water features should be placed nearby but not in constant spray to avoid chilling or excessive humidity. Regularly check for overheating signs, such as rapid respiration or lethargy, and relocate animals promptly to cooler spaces.
For mammals with fur or feather insulation, gradual cooling is essential. Offer multiple soft, secluded pockets lined with natural materials like grass, moss, or dry leaves. A combination of low, medium, and elevated retreats helps individuals choose based on comfort and safety needs. Ensure that shade structures are robust enough to withstand local weather, including wind and hail. Avoid creating hot pockets beneath decks or dense coverings where heat can trapped. By providing varied refuges, you respect species-specific preferences and strengthen welfare during heat waves.
Long-term planning means integrating refuges into daily routines and seasonal shifts. Review shelter placement as summers arrive or intensify, moving elements to reflect shifting sun angles. Consider the potential for refuges to double as moisture reservoirs during dry spells, offering both cooling and hydration opportunities. Encourage guardianship that observes how animals use the spaces, noting preferred routes and habitual retreat times. Clear signage or cues can guide caretakers to adjust refuges quickly, reducing stress during sudden heat spikes or changes in climate patterns. Regular maintenance sustains reliability and animal confidence in the environment.
